             Summary: Artifact checksums not always generated for remote proxy
                 Key: MRM-1899
                 URL: https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/MRM-1899
             Project: Archiva
          Issue Type: Bug
          Components: remote proxy
    Affects Versions: 2.2.0
            Reporter: Gwyn Connor


Archiva sometimes does not create checksums (and metadata) for proxied POM-only 
artifacts from remote repository when they are downloaded for the first time. 
It downloads the .pom and writes the pom's content to .sha1 and .md5 files.

Any tool using the checksum files will fail, because they do not contain 
checksums but are corrupt (i. e. they contain the XML content from the POM).

Running a directory scan on the managed repository fixes the checksum files and 
creates the metadata.

I can reproduce this behaviour everytime on an empty repository, when I try to 
download artifacts from Maven Central proxy with Gradle. I've attached the 
Archiva logs (with INFO level enabled). You can see that checksums for 
org/apache/apache/13/apache-13.pom are only created after manually starting a 
directory scan.
